The book highlights the value of intelligence with the example of the 7th October Terror attack by Hamas on Israel and Israels response. The author is not relevantly critical of Israels actions, it is Hamas he criticises. You can agree or disagree with this, it is still a very interesting example and useful to understand the role of intelligence. That said, the author could have delved far deeper into mistakes and misperceptions. He (probably) did not as a lot is still unkown for the public. Instead, the author explores the region and the role of intelligence in Germany. This was all interesting, but I would preferred more about mistakes and events around October 7 from an insider and intelligence point of view.
